Output 45898158c698a52724354c9336699520a567c798529ae1bb42a6623010078d15:89

value
863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3218a5d586f08daa75edde72f2c5723ea5ab05e7ba748c2176c1940975ea0227
address
bc1pxgv2t4vx7zx65a0dmee093tj86j6kp08hf6gcgtkcx2qja02qgnscg7u3y
transaction
45898158c698a52724354c9336699520a567c798529ae1bb42a6623010078d15
spent
true